Quotations
Freedom
Freedom is only the freedom to say no.
- Jean Paul Sartre
If you want to be free, there is but one way; it is to guarantee an equally full measure of liberty to all your neighbors. There is no other.
- Carl Schurz
Most people would look at an animal in a cage and instinctively feel that it should be set free. . . . It's a dangerous world out there, filled with predators. . . . What would you prefer? A comfortable, safe, warm, cosy life in a cage, or an uncertain life of freedom.
- Scarlett Thomas
Freedom: both so priceless and so expensive.
- Patricia Duncker
Freedom of the press is limited to those who own one.
- A. J. Liebling
Freedom is realizing you have a choice.
- T. F. Hodge
Freedom has cost too much blood and agony to be relinquished at the cheap price of rhetoric.
- Thomas Sowell
Freedom is what we do with what is done to us.
- Jean Paul Sartre
Nobody objected to live in prison
if already felt comfortable living in it.
- Toba Beta
It has been said that each generation must win its own struggle to be free.
- Robert F. Kennedy
